Survey: IT Experts Confident of Ability to Detect Critical Attacks
A new survey of over 400 energy executives and IT professionals in the energy, oil, gas and utility industries found that most energy security professionals were extremely confident in their ability to detect a cyber-attack on critical systems, with 86% stating they could detect a breach in less than one week. Tripwire, Inc., a leading global provider of advanced threat, security and compliance solutions, announced the results of the survey conducted by Dimensional Research. It found that 49% of all respondents believe their organization could detect a cyberattack on a critical system within 24 hours.
